Rigoletto Thu 16 - Sat 18 Jun at The Grand Opera House Belfast
Verdi's towering opera tells a tragic tale. Rigoletto, a jester employed by a rich and dissolute Duke, is forced to keep his master well supplied with fresh conquests.
As a web of court intrigue tightens around him, Rigoletto finds himself the victim of a grave curse, but to his horror, it's his carefully protected daughter Gilda who is the one to suffer.
From the aching naivety of Gilda's first love to the Duke's unthinking revelry and Rigoletto's tortured realisation of his failure as a father, Verdi takes the characters from elation to despair in an opera densely packed with extraordinary music.
Director Matthew Richardson brings this operatic classic to the stage in a stylish, intelligent and theatrical production. English baritone Eddie Wade sings Rigoletto in his debut in the role, and Nadine Livingston (Musetta in 2010's La bohème) brings a fresh innocence to the role of Gilda. Tobias Ringborg conducts.
